About the project
I’m putting together a one-minute, motion-picture-quality trailer that blends realistic 3D animation with a vivid fantasy storyline. The piece opens on an ocean marina steeped in Salt Life culture, then sweeps viewers into a world where majestic boats cut through sapphire water and magical creatures rise from the depths. Rich, mystical landscapes frame the action; every shot should feel cinematic, with physically-based lighting, dramatic camera moves, and film-level compositing. What I need from you: • A full 60-second 3D animated trailer delivered as a high-resolution video file (minimum 4K). • Realistic character, creature, and environment modeling that holds up to close-ups. • Fluid ocean simulations, spray, and cloth dynamics on sails to keep the boat sequences believable. • Seamless integration of fantasy elements—think glowing runes on hulls, translucent fish, or other magical touches—while maintaining a grounded, tactile look. • Final color-grade, sound design, and a short title card so the piece is ready to screen. Preferred tools include Blender, Maya, Houdini, or Unreal Engine, but I’m open as long as the result meets theater-quality standards. Please share links to previous realistic fantasy or ocean-based animation work; seeing polished water simulations or creature rigs will help me decide quickly. Once we align on storyboards and an asset list, I’ll approve milestone hand-offs for animatic, first lighting pass, and final compositing.
